## Keyturn 3.2.0 — Changed defaults

Keyturn, our internal secrets-rotation utility, now rotates database credentials every 14 days instead of 30, and the grace window for dual-validity has been shortened from 48 to 12 hours. Retry backoff is now exponential by default. Teams that pinned the old schedule in their overrides are unaffected; everyone else picks up the new behavior on the next rotation cycle. No action is needed for the Larkspur cluster. The effective defaults shipped with this release are as follows.

config for kajog-tadug:
[casax]
port = 11211
region = west-3
host = casax.nelvroworks.internal
timeout_ms = 5000
retries = 7

Q: How do I unlock the Vramlens profiling vault after a plugin crash?

A: Plugin authors hitting a sealed capture store should restart the Vramlens daemon, confirm the allocator snapshot replays cleanly, then run the recovery flow from the plugin SDK. The flow prompts for the vault recovery passphrase before re-enabling trace export. The passphrase is:

strongbox words: novwyn-julvan-weniel-jorax-sorix-pelath-druwyn-druok-soreth

# Break-Glass: Catalog Cache Invalidation

Scope: the Pinrow product catalog at Veldstone Retail. If stale prices persist after a purge and the Hollowmere invalidation queue is wedged, use break-glass to flush the edge tier directly. Contractors: get verbal sign-off from the catalog lead first. Steps: open the Hollowmere admin shell, select emergency-flush, confirm the tenant, and run it once — repeated flushes thrash the origin. Access is logged and expires after 20 minutes. Unseal the admin shell with the passphrase below.

recovery phrase for kahop-tajog: istix-casvan

Handover — Crashwren pipeline

Plugin-facing notes: ingest endpoint is unchanged; symbolication moved to a queue, so reports may lag up to two minutes. Plugins must not retry on 202. Schema v3 is mandatory next quarter. Everything else is stable. Plugins should validate against the pipeline settings listed below.

service settings:
[silwyn]
host = silwyn.crelvogrid.internal
user = silwyn_svc
database = silwyn_prod